Поделиться через


Server Memory Change, класс событий

Область применения: SQL Server База данных SQL Azure Управляемый экземпляр SQL Azure

Класс событий "Изменение памяти сервера" возникает при увеличении или уменьшении использования памяти Microsoft SQL Server на 1 мегабайт (МБ) или на 5 процентов максимальной памяти сервера, в зависимости от того, что больше.

Столбцы данных класса событий Server Memory Change

Имя столбца данных Тип данных Description Идентификатор столбца Да
EventClass int Тип события = 81. 27 No
EventSequence int Последовательность данного события в запросе. 51 No
EventSubClass int Тип подкласса события.

1 = увеличение памяти

2 = уменьшение памяти
21 Да
IntegerData int Новый объем памяти в мегабайтах (МБ). 25 Да
IsSystem int Указывает, произошло событие в системном или в пользовательском процессе. 1 = системный, 0 = пользовательский. 60 Да
RequestID int Идентификатор запроса, содержащего инструкцию. 49 Да
ServerName nvarchar Имя отслеживаемого экземпляра SQL Server. 26 No
SessionLoginName nvarchar Имя входа пользователя, который инициировал сеанс. Например, если вы подключаетесь к SQL Server с помощью Login1 и выполняете инструкцию login2, SessionLoginName показывает Login1 и LoginName показывает Login2. В этом столбце отображаются имена входа SQL Server и Windows. 64 Да
SPID int Идентификатор сеанса, в котором произошло событие. 12 Да
StartTime datetime Время начала события, если оно известно. 14 Да
TransactionID bigint Назначенный системой идентификатор транзакции. 4 Да
XactSequence bigint Токен, который описывает текущую транзакцию. 50 Да

См. также

Расширенные события
sp_trace_setevent (Transact-SQL)
Параметры конфигурации сервера «Server Memory»